What are the Benefits of Using a Weed Eater Rack for a Trailer?

Using a dedicated weed eater rack offers several key advantages:

  • Protection: Racks prevent damage to your valuable weed eaters during transport. They cushion the equipment against bumps and jostling, extending their lifespan.
  • Organization: A well-designed rack keeps your equipment neatly organized, making it easy to locate and access specific tools quickly. This saves time and improves efficiency on the job site.
  • Safety: Securely storing your weed eaters prevents them from shifting during transit, reducing the risk of accidents or damage to other equipment. This is particularly important for heavier, gas-powered models.
  • Space Optimization: A properly planned rack maximizes trailer space, allowing you to carry more equipment efficiently. This is vital for professionals with a variety of tools.
  • Professionalism: A neat and organized trailer reflects professionalism and contributes to a positive image for your business.

What Types of Weed Eater Racks are Available for Trailers?

Several options exist, each with its strengths and weaknesses:

1. Wall-Mounted Racks:

These racks attach directly to the trailer's sidewalls, offering a vertical storage solution. They are ideal for space-saving and are particularly useful for smaller trailers or when combined with other storage solutions.

2. Adjustable Racks:

These racks often feature adjustable straps or clamps, allowing you to accommodate different sizes and types of weed eaters. This flexibility is excellent if you use multiple models or need to adapt to different equipment.

3. Heavy-Duty Racks:

Made from robust materials like steel, heavy-duty racks are built to withstand the rigors of transporting heavier, gas-powered weed eaters. They provide superior protection and durability.

4. Custom-Built Racks:

For ultimate customization, you can have a rack built to your precise specifications. This allows for optimal space utilization and the integration of other tools and equipment.

How to Choose the Right Weed Eater Rack for Your Trailer

Choosing the ideal weed eater rack depends on several factors:

  • Type and size of weed eaters: Consider the number and weight of your weed eaters, as well as their dimensions.
  • Trailer size and configuration: Measure your trailer's available space and consider the position and type of mounting points available.
  • Budget: Racks range in price from economical options to more expensive, custom-built solutions.
  • Desired features: Think about features like adjustability, material strength, and ease of use.

How to Securely Mount Weed Eaters on a Trailer Rack?

Always secure weed eaters using the appropriate straps, clamps, or other fastening mechanisms provided with the rack. Ensure the weed eaters are snug and cannot shift during transit. Over-tightening can damage the equipment, so use caution.

What Materials are Best for Weed Eater Racks?

Durable materials such as steel, aluminum, and heavy-duty plastics are commonly used for weed eater racks. Steel offers excellent strength but can be heavier. Aluminum is lighter but might be more expensive. Plastic racks are often the most budget-friendly option.

Can I Build My Own Weed Eater Rack for My Trailer?

Yes, with the right tools and materials, building a custom rack is possible. However, ensure you have the necessary skills and safety precautions in place. Careful planning and measurements are essential to ensure a secure and functional rack.
